327 students start internships

JAKARTA (JP): At least 327 University of Indonesia students will participate in corporate intern programs to gain knowledge, experience and skills.

Bhenyamin Hoessein, an internship coordinator, said 261 of the 327 students in the 21-day program, which starts today, are studying at the D-III education level in the university's school of social and political sciences.

The other 66 are from the school's undergraduate program, he said.

"The intern program, which was introduced four years ago, is hoped to provide the students with valuable experiences and to expose them to real situations in daily life," Bhenyamin was quoted by Antara as saying.

He said the companies participating in the program include, among others, Lippo Bank and tax service offices throughout Greater Jakarta. (hhr)
